Choosing Your 10–12 Capsule Pieces

Pick a Color Palette

Start with 3 neutrals (black, white, beige, gray) and mix in 2–3 accent shades (olive, navy, blush—whatever feels “you”). Keeping a color story means everything mixes and matches without thinking.

Think in Layers and Seasons

Choose items that layer well. You’ll want pieces you can style differently as the weather (and your mood) changes.

Sample Capsule Piece List:

  • Tops: white button-up, neutral knit, graphic tee, silky blouse

  • Bottoms: tailored trousers, classic jeans, midi skirt

  • Layers: blazer, denim jacket, long cardigan

  • Wildcards: dress, statement piece, or seasonal trend (just one!)

Pro tip: Go for quality over quantity. You’ll wear these pieces on repeat.

The Outfit Formula: Multiply Like Magic

Here’s the fun math (I promise this isn’t school):
With 4 tops × 3 bottoms × 2 layers = 24 outfitsbefore accessories or switching shoes. Add in 2 dresses or a jumpsuit, and you’re easily at 30+ unique combinations.

Example Outfit Rotations:

  1. White tee + jeans + blazer = Casual coffee run

  2. Silk blouse + midi skirt + cardigan = Elegant dinner

  3. Graphic tee + trousers + denim jacket = Cool girl energy

  4. Button-up + skirt (tied at waist) = Playful weekend look

  5. Knit top + trousers + boots = Effortless chic

See? With the right capsule, you can rotate pieces like a fashion magician.

The Power of Accessories

You didn’t think we’d stop at clothes, right?

How to Instantly Switch the Vibe:

  • Belts: Add shape or break up an outfit

  • Scarves: One piece, 10 styling options

  • Shoes: Sneakers = casual, boots = edgy, loafers = preppy

  • Bags: A mini crossbody changes everything

Accessories let you take the same base outfit from errands to a night out.

FAQs You Might Be Wondering​

“What if I get bored of the same pieces?”

Totally valid. That’s where accessories, layering, and mixing textures come in. Even a swap of shoes or bag can make an outfit feel fresh.

“How do I rotate for different seasons?”

Keep your core capsule but swap seasonal items:

  • Winter? Add a chunky knit, tights, boots.

  • Summer? Switch to linen, sandals, light layers.
    Store off-season items out of sight so your capsule always feels crisp.

“Can I still follow trends?”

Absolutely! Just pick 1–2 trend pieces that complement your capsule—like a metallic skirt or a trending color top. Sprinkle, don’t soak.

Mistakes to Avoid (Because I Made Them All)

Picking Pieces That Don’t Match Each Other

If you need to try five combos before finding one that looks okay… it’s not capsule-worthy. Each piece should mix effortlessly with most of the others.

Overcomplicating the Capsule

You don’t need 25 items. You need intentional ones. If it doesn’t fit well, feel great, or play nicely with others—it’s out.

Forgetting Your Lifestyle

A capsule wardrobe must match your life. If you work from home, you don’t need five pencil skirts. If you travel a lot, choose wrinkle-proof fabrics and comfy staples.

Weekly Rotation Plan (A.K.A. Lazy Girl’s Guide)

Here’s a fun way to rotate without overthinking:

Monday–Friday Breakdown:

  • Monday: Classic — Button-up + trousers + loafers

  • Tuesday: Creative — Graphic tee + skirt + denim jacket

  • Wednesday: Cozy — Knit + jeans + cardigan

  • Thursday: Edgy — Silk blouse + boots + blazer

  • Friday: Chill — Tee + jeans + sneakers

Weekend Vibes:

  • Saturday: Dress with sneakers + crossbody

  • Sunday: Midi skirt + white tee + sandals

Pro Tips to Keep It Fun

  • Snap mirror selfies when you nail a combo so you remember it later

  • Keep a “capsule journal” (even Notes app works) to plan outfit combos

  • Set a rule: One in, one out—if you buy something new, remove one item from the capsule

This keeps your wardrobe lean and mean.
